Output 762a5adcbfcca00cb17f3e53fbdad395fde84fe9595535b467995f321db071ac:8

value
11488089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a91276327881e26da489afd1a5b5c23758582830 OP_EQUAL
address
MPK8YbFw68eTEhthnukRGKydczQUC7Jshz
transaction
762a5adcbfcca00cb17f3e53fbdad395fde84fe9595535b467995f321db071ac
spent
true